Team News

Peterborough
Wrexham
  • With Hector Kyprianou fit, Peterborough are likely to be unchanged from winning at Exeter last time out.
  • Paul Mullin could have to settle for a place on the bench despite making his comeback from injury against Reading.

Prediction

  • Following a poor result against Huddersfield on the opening-day, six goals and six points from away trips to Shrewsbury and Exeter firmly has Peterborough back on track.
  • Posh rarely lose at home and are unbeaten against Wrexham in their last ten meetings (W4 D6) altogether.
  • Wrexham have made an excellent start to life in League One with seven points from first three games putting them inside the play-offs.
  • The Red Dragons have looked unstoppable in their two home games, scoring six goals, but will need to be at their absolute best to continue their unbeaten start.
